Tran Van Tam is a scholar working on Materials Chemistry, Biomedical Engineering and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Tran Van Tam has authored 27 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Materials Chemistry, 11 papers in Biomedical Engineering and 9 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Tran Van Tam's work include Carbon and Quantum Dots Applications (8 papers), Advanced Photocatalysis Techniques (8 papers) and Supercapacitor Materials and Fabrication (7 papers). Tran Van Tam is often cited by papers focused on Carbon and Quantum Dots Applications (8 papers), Advanced Photocatalysis Techniques (8 papers) and Supercapacitor Materials and Fabrication (7 papers). Tran Van Tam collaborates with scholars based in South Korea, Vietnam and Thailand. Tran Van Tam's co-authors include Won Mook Choi, Jin Suk Chung, Seung Hyun Hur, Sung Gu Kang, Nguyễn Bảo Trung, Seung Geol Lee, Hye Ryeon Kim, Firoz Babu Kadumudi, Eun‐Suok Oh and Eui Jung Kim and has published in prestigious journals such as Advanced Energy Materials, Chemical Engineering Journal and Journal of Materials Chemistry A.
